/// Byte offset for moving the cursor one line up (`direction == -1`) or down
/// (`direction == 1`), keeping roughly the same column. Returns `None` when
/// there is no line in that direction (so single-line inputs never move).
pub(in crate::tui) fn vertical_cursor_target(
    input: &str,
    cursor: usize,
    direction: isize,
) -> Option<usize> {
    let cursor = grapheme_boundary_at_or_before(input, clamp_cursor_index(input, cursor));
    let line_start = line_start_before(input, cursor);
    let line_end = line_end_after(input, cursor);
    let column = UnicodeWidthStr::width(&input[line_start..cursor]);

    match direction {
        -1 => {
            if line_start == 0 {
                return None;
            }
            let target_end = line_start - 1;
            let target_start = line_start_before(input, target_end);
            Some(byte_index_for_line_column(
                input,
                target_start,
                target_end,
                column,
            ))
        }
        1 => {
            let next_start = line_end.checked_add(1)?;
            if next_start > input.len() {
                return None;
            }
            let target_end = line_end_after(input, next_start);
            Some(byte_index_for_line_column(
                input, next_start, target_end, column,
            ))
        }
        _ => None,
    }
}

fn line_start_before(input: &str, index: usize) -> usize {
    input[..index]
        .rfind('\n')
        .map(|offset| offset + '\n'.len_utf8())
        .unwrap_or(0)
}

fn line_end_after(input: &str, index: usize) -> usize {
    input[index..]
        .find('\n')
        .map(|offset| index + offset)
        .unwrap_or(input.len())
}

fn grapheme_boundary_at_or_before(input: &str, index: usize) -> usize {
    if index == input.len() {
        return index;
    }
    input
        .grapheme_indices(true)
        .map(|(start, _)| start)
        .take_while(|start| *start <= index)
        .last()
        .unwrap_or(0)
}

fn byte_index_for_line_column(input: &str, start: usize, end: usize, column: usize) -> usize {
    let line = &input[start..end];
    let mut width = 0usize;
    let mut best_index = start;
    let mut best_distance = column;

    for (offset, grapheme) in line.grapheme_indices(true) {
        let next_width = width.saturating_add(UnicodeWidthStr::width(grapheme));
        let next_distance = next_width.abs_diff(column);
        if next_distance <= best_distance {
            best_index = start + offset + grapheme.len();
            best_distance = next_distance;
        }
        if next_width >= column {
            return best_index;
        }
        width = next_width;
    }

    end
}
